Cornell Lab of Ornithology: Scientists Just Mapped the Family Tree of 11,000+ Bird Species—And You Can Explore It

Cornell Lab of Ornithology: Scientists Just Mapped the Family Tree of 11,000+ Bird Species—And You Can Explore It. “The Cornell Lab of Ornithology today announced the release of a new online tool for studying biodiversity and the evolutionary relationships among birds: the illustrated Birds of the World Phylogeny Explorer.
